Appearance

An eyepatch is present on his right eye. Two large armor plates which he fastens to himself with three collars. He usually keeps them under his clothes.

Personality

From an early age James has learnt that kindness won't bring you very far in this vile world. He tries to be as cold and emotionless toward people with which he has business. He is really easily made angry and quickly gets irritated by people who ask too many questions.

History

Born in Stormwind, Butch wasn't given the chance to enjoy the glamour of the big city. As a son of simple citizen, he wasn't aware of most of the things happening outside the walls. James was a very problematic child always starting fights with other children and getting involved in actions unacceptable by the rules of the Keep. He was often disciplined for his deeds, though he never seemed to change his behavior.

Being such a stubborn kid, his father sent him at an early age to help one of the town's blacksmiths. He didn't resisted to work but continued to show little respect towards his parents. During his time as an apprentice he managed to learn a few things about making weapons and armor. His body was put to its limit as he worked, making him really tough for a kid his age. At the age of fourteen he already had left his parents and started learning sword fighting with some of his friends, while still working as a blacksmith.

By the time he was sixteen, the future of Stormwind was at stake. Hordes of wicked orcs invaded the lands. With no hesitation he volunteered to join the navy. A wise decision that might have saved his life. It wasn't the first time he was on a boat but it was the first warship he was going to be on. He was stationed on "The Spearhead" which was to provide naval support. With the city being taken over the fleet was forced to retreat to the shores of Lordaeron.

When James got established there, he decided to leave the navy and join merchant ships sailing around Azeroth. He wasn't one of the best seamen around but with time James started learning the tricks of the trade. And so, from one ship to another he started saving gold for his very own ship. But his dream didn't get to come true. Both his captain and a large of part of the crew got ill during a voyage. He was forced to stay in a merchant port situated in the jungles of eastern Azeroth. A place not that favorable to honest men. There was plenty of work to be done around. With a lot of manual labour the young man managed to make a living.

As time passed he got involved in some criminal organizations. His attitude helped him a lot to rise in the hierarchy. He became a smuggler, crossing the seas and visiting many places. During this time he got his nickname "Butch". "He was in a tavern, late at night, celebrating another job well done, when a bunch of bounty hunters came in and started looking for him... " the story has many different versions from this point over but they all end the same way. The bounty hunters got slain making the inn as bloody as a butchery and James loosing an eye in the fight." Weather fictitious or not, from this day onwards, Butch started to wear an eyepatch even though it was stated by some people that both of his eyes are well. Also no one seems to recall such an event even happening, thus regarding it as a tall tale.

During the ongoing wars, he kept a low profile, avoiding any involvement. When the third war was at its end, James had a little encounter with paladins going to the Plaguelands. Even though he fought undead at some point, he didn't get involved in any serious battles. Somewhere at that time he used his blacksmithing abilities to forge the armor plates which would become like a second skin to him. It is believed that they were forged from the stolen armor of fallen fighters scattered around the battlefield because of the lack of materials.

Nowadays he enjoys a somewhat calm life still working on ships, trying to stay away from any major troubles.
